Technical Details

  • Rated voltage of 12V
  • Rated capacity of 1650mAh
  • Can be recharged using existing NP-E2 charger
  • Recharges in about 120 minutes
  • Seams that come into contact with the EOS-1D are lined with silicon rubber packing to enhance water and dust resistance

Don't be disappointed because this isn't a lithium ion battery. This battery kicks butt!! It lasted me 3 days of non stop shooting. I started to think that the battery was never going to die! Of course reality set in and had to eventually charge it, but it lasted forever!! The only drawback is that it takes about 2 hours to charge:( Other than that, it will lasts you all day and night.
